## Session Handling — Relevance Tuning Notes (Plumeria Search)

Quick heads-up before the cut: the new synonym boosts only apply when the session carries the `rel-tune` flag, so don't panic if staging results look stale in a fresh browser. We bumped recency decay from 0.3 to 0.45 and it noticeably helps the long-tail queries. To replay the tuning suite against staging, use the bearer token below.

session JWT of yawep-yawep = eyJhbGciOiJIUzI1NiIsInR5cCI6IkpXVCJ9.eyJzdWIiOiI3pWF3_In0.aXYsHiog

# Break-Glass Access: LedgerLens Audit-Log Viewer

LedgerLens is the read-only audit-log viewer used by the Trustwork compliance group. Normal access flows through group membership; break-glass applies only when the identity provider is down and an active investigation cannot wait. Break-glass sessions are recorded, time-boxed to four hours, and reviewed by the Varnholt security board within two business days. To initiate, open the sealed recovery flow from the console's offline login screen. The flow will prompt for the passphrase below.

strongbox words: caswyn-druwyn

The renewal of our three-year agreement with Torvane Materials has been assessed in detail. Proposed terms include a 4.2% unit-price increase, partially offset by improved volume rebates and extended payment terms of sixty days. Sensitivity analysis indicates a net annual cost impact of under 1% on the Meridia product line, assuming stable demand. Legal has flagged no material changes to liability clauses. We recommend approval, subject to the conditions outlined in the confidential note below.

confidential, yawip-bahif: Zorokox Partners plans to lower the Casax list price by 28.0 percent in April. The board signed off on a budget of $271.0 million for Project Juldor. The renewal with Pelokox Partners closes at $410.1 million a year, 3.4 percent below the last contract. Project Pelok slips by a full year because of the audit delay.

// Shipping fee rules engine (Portwain project).
// This constant caps the number of rule-evaluation passes per
// shipment. Circular zone overrides were once possible via the
// Delvora carrier table, so we hard-stop after this many passes
// and fall back to the flat regional rate. Do not raise it without
// profiling. The build that introduced the cap is noted below.

build token for kagaf-hahof: htk14_9d3d4d26d7d8de